Slow Cooker Mariana Sauce

Slow Cooker Mariana Sauce is so much better than anything you can get in a jar. You’re going to love this simple recipe made with inexpensive staple ingredients.

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 cup onion diced
  • 1 cup green bell pepper diced
  • 3 cloves garlic minced
  • 2 cans 15 oz diced tomatoes
  • 2 cans 15 oz tomato sauce
  • 1 teaspoon oregano
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• 1/2 teaspoon basil
  • sal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ium high heat and brown ground beef.
  2. Transfer ground beef to slow cooker then add onions, bell peppers, and garlic.
  3. Next pour in cans of diced tomatoes, and tomato sauce. Add the seasonings, salt and pepper and stir to combine.
  4. Finally, cover and set the slow cooker to cook on low for four to six hours.
  5. Serve over pasta for freeze
  6. Garnish with parsley if desired
